in view of the upcoming LHC experiments

 

The School aims to provide a general background on the theory and phenomenology of Quark Gluon Plasma  built on the expertise developed at SPS and RHIC, in view of the forthcoming LHC facility at CERN. It is suitable for undergraduate, graduate and postdoctoral students who plan to actively engage in this area of research, as well as for those who specialise in nearby fields of strong interactions and nuclear physics.
